Deregulálják is a Hungarian word that translates to "deregulation" in English. It refers to the process of removing or reducing government regulations and restrictions on businesses, industries, or specific sectors of the economy. The primary aim of deregulation is often to foster competition, encourage innovation, and stimulate economic growth by reducing the burden on businesses and allowing market forces to play a more significant role.
